Here is an updated full version of the staircase scheduler (not attached for
brevity of email):
http://ck.kolivas.org/patches/2.6/2.6.7-rc3/patch-2.6.7-rc3-s6.4
25 files changed, 264 insertions(+), 545 deletions(-)
Changes:
Tiny bugfixes, cleanups.
Slight tweak to tasks waiting on I/O
Massive cleanups from wli - thanks!
Comments, testing welcome
